[Bug 1205397] Re: encrypted install fails because unsafe swap (zram) is detected

2017-12-01 Thread Mathieu Trudel-Lapierre
Indeed, for now the solution will have to be to disable zram before installing for LVM2 with crypto. So; for zram, I think the solution will be "involved". Not overly complex, but I think it needs a small rework of seeds. zram is compressed, not encrypted. It would be downright wrong to ignore zra
